Lucky colors for Chinese New Year. Red. Red symbolizes good fortune, positivity and vitality and is the luckiest color for Chinese New Year celebrations. Red is During Chinese New Year, red is the most popular color in China, because folk believe that this color will bring in good fortune and scare away evil spirits. You will see all kinds of decorations in red, including red lanterns, couplets and paper-cuttings. Each zodiac sign has different forecasts for the new lunar year. However, the Chinese New Year firecrackers and fireworks that are symbols of Chinese New Year have a different meaning than those for other holidays. It is believed that the loud noises and the flashes of light from both firecrackers and fireworks could scare away evil spirits and usher in good fortune.
